Output 51cdf58cbddd937e13388c40da69f33eea51809bca771d7f701a37efee4335eb:0

value
19598725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1f9018793cb02d8fa8145017a8d973718ea3f4d OP_EQUALVERIFY OP_CHECKSIG
address
1L9EXLCXKBPFB53fxiaBLr7JeJEvgoTMoT
transaction
51cdf58cbddd937e13388c40da69f33eea51809bca771d7f701a37efee4335eb
spent
true